Support is King [Holographic Game]- Chapter 15

Jiang Shi really didn’t expect that Yu Weize would have no team. He thought for a moment and chose [Agree]

In less than a second after Yu Weize joined the team, the entire team channel was filled with question marks.

Deep Well Ice Player, also opened a friend window and sent a message.

[Deep Well Ice Player: ?]

[Deep Well Ice Player: How did he join the team? Why did you invite him?!]

Jiang Shi still had the energy to reply, “Don’t worry, free labor, no harm in using it.”

[Deep Well Ice Player: Aren’t you afraid he’ll play dirty?]

Jiang Shi replied, “Don’t worry, I’m watching.”

Even though the text conversation didn’t convey tone, Deep Well Ice Player still felt the calmness between the lines.

He thought for a moment and realized that there probably wasn’t any output that couldn’t be managed, so he didn’t say anything more.

After the team channel was flooded with messages for a moment, it gradually quieted down.

Not because the members of the Seven Silver Coins were particularly calm, but because all the restless people had switched to private messages using exclamation points.

[What Pen Carries Fragrance: OMG, I can’t believe someone I know in real life is the God Yu!]

[What Pen Carries Fragrance: No wonder those Crusaders were willing to help us earlier!]

[What Pen Carries Fragrance: I’ve seen God Yu alive!]

[Island Forest: Sweetie, I hope you stay calm here.]

[What Pen Carries Fragrance: Aaaaaah!]

Yu Weize seemed to be completely unaffected by the atmosphere.

He opened the team voice chat, and just the tone of his greeting made it sound like he had joined his own guild’s team: “Long time no see.”

Jiang Shi also replied naturally, “Yeah, long time no see.”

Yu Weize asked, “Are you planning to come back and play this time?”

Jiang Shi thought for a moment, “I guess so, can’t say for sure.”

Yu Weize chuckled, “Why can’t you say for sure?”

Jiang Shi said, “Oh, ‘can’t say for sure’ just means I can’t say for sure.”

Yu Weize asked, “Can you at least tell me why you deleted me as a friend?”

Jiang Shi used a puzzled tone, “What friend deletion?”

As soon as he said that, a system message popped up.

[Yu Weize has requested to add you as a friend, [Accept] or [Decline].]

Without hesitation, Jiang Shi chose to decline, “Oh, I remembered, I did delete you.”

Yu Weize raised an eyebrow, “So, did I offend you in some way?”

Jiang Shi smiled lightly, “Not at all, it’s just a precaution.”

Yu Weize asked, “Hmm?”

Jiang Shi hinted with a slightly extended tone, “If you need a reason, how about reducing the chances of being pursued by your Crusaders?”

Yu Weize’s tone carried a hint of surprise, “Why would the Crusaders be after you?”

Jiang Shi feigned surprise as well, “You don’t know?”

Yu Weize casually spoke nonsense with his eyes closed, “I don’t know. I just passed by and came over to say hello when I saw you. Is there some misunderstanding? Should I ask on your behalf?”

Jiang Shi chuckled meaningfully, “Oh, that’s really kind of you.”

The entire team, from the voice channel to the team chat, fell silent. Only the two of them were engaged in a synchronized flurry of actions during their casual conversation.

Skills fell on the Madman Tate frequently, and with the targeted aggro effect triggered every 1.5 seconds, the target’s aggro naturally shifted towards the intended target during the frenzy of attacks.

This was the effect Jiang Shi wanted.

Although he didn’t have a taunt skill like a knight, using this seemingly useless frequent output was enough to attract Madman Tate’s attention and gradually lead him away from his original position.

All the players who had been surrounding the area had scattered on their own command.

Despite occasionally checking the situation here during the chaos, they obviously didn’t dare to act because they couldn’t figure out the specific circumstances.

If there was only one Light Elf on the scene, it could be understood as a returning player not understanding the mechanics, but now there was an unexpected appearance of Yu Weize from somewhere. No other players from the Crusaders’ guild had arrived, and no one knew what was happening here.

What was even more surprising was that the initial intention of the Light Elf, which was to attack Yu Weize, seemed to have changed as the skill was released and caused no damage. It appeared that he had directly invited Yu Weize to the team.

But why?

In the eyes of the Night Raid team, this was undeniable evidence of an alliance between the Crusaders and the Seven Silver Coins. The other two guilds, on the other hand, were left completely bewildered.

The less they understood, the less they knew how to react.

The commanders of the three guilds could only hold their breath and prepare to launch an attack once the 30-second frenzy phase was over.

It wasn’t until almost 20 seconds had passed that someone finally realized something was amiss.

Wait, why is this BOSS getting further and further away from them?!

The Night Raid’s commander was the first to react, “Quick! Where’s the main tank? Prepare to draw aggro!”

As the Night Raid team made a move, the other two guilds also snapped out of it and rushed forward, engaging in combat while struggling with aggro control.

Jiang Shi kept an eye on the rear, and when he saw all three guilds taking action, a faint smile crossed his face.

Having made preparations in advance, the rune domains he had already set up were activated the moment everyone stepped into them.

Rooting, burning speed, silencing, sleeping, confusion…

One after another, the rune domains directly threw the charge formations of the three guilds into chaos.

In this chaotic scene, there was no chance for anyone to scrutinize the situation closely. Otherwise, if someone took a moment to think, they would likely be dumbfounded.

Like Rune Masters, who relied on special items, and other “artisan” professions like Mechanics, Alchemists, and War Smiths, their strength mainly depended on the number of controls they could achieve. Even in the current version, where Rune Masters were almost extinct, top professional players were still active in the Century Cup, with the most famous being the Lone Tomb from the Rattlesnake Guild.

Back then, Lone Tomb had unleashed a chain of six rune domains during a tournament, shocking the entire Creative Genesis Continent.

Six perfect rune domains were already considered the best performance by a top-tier expert like Lone Tomb. At this moment, Jiang Shi had already completed the placement of the seventh rune domain and was continuing to operate.

If there was anything lacking, it could only be regret about the relatively weak domain effects of the low-level rune stones he was currently using.

Of course, he had more than enough to handle the current situation.

Jiang Shi had already completed his Second Awakening.

The Second Awakening’s passive effect for Rune Masters extended the duration of their rune domains by 20%. Meanwhile, while in the [Rune Spirit] state he had activated, for every additional rune domain on the field, the effective range of all domains increased by an additional 2%.

These rune field covered the battlefield extensively, buying enough time for the transfer of Madman Tate.

While providing perfect cover, Jiang Shi also maintained a reasonable distance, closely observing Yu Weize’s every move.

The spare rune stone he held was specifically prepared for this individual. As long as there was a hint of extra thought during the operation, it was ready to kick him from the team, seal him in place, or throw him into the enemy formation in the rear, providing professional service all in one.

Fortunately, Yu Weize had shown enough cooperation so far.

Although he hadn’t asked Jiang Shi about the plan from start to finish, just the area where the Seven Silver Coins team and Deep Well Ice Player were stationed was enough for him to infer the complete action plan.

Now it was up to him to lead Madman Tate.

While Jiang Shi provided cover from the rear, Yu Weize had successfully passed the BOSS to What Pen Carries Fragrance.

The 30-second frenzy phase had just ended.

As the only Knight player in the team, What Pen Carries Fragrance provocatively applied his skills to draw aggro, and just as Jiang Shi had arranged, he took charge of Madman Tate, who had only 9.9% of his health left, and began to run towards Shen Jing Bing.

Seeing that the handover had gone smoothly on this end, Jiang Shi glanced at the charging forces that were about to break free from his rune domains and had no intention of lingering in the fight.

After symbolically dropping a few rune domains behind him for cover, he turned and ran without looking back.

As they watched the BOSS being taken from under their noses, the commanders of the three guilds felt like they were going to spit blood. Now that they had finally escaped the interference of the rune domains, their orders were clear and unified: “Take down the Seven Silver Coins members first!”

Gritting his teeth, one of them added, “Including Yu Weize!”

Although Madman Tate’s loot wasn’t that great, weekly field boss kills were recorded, and if word got out that a casual guild had snatched it away, it would be a major loss of face.

In the midst of What Pen Carries Fragrance’s run, he could feel the ground faintly shaking. As he approached the target location, he had to shout, “What’s next? Do I call the main guild leader?”

Jiang Shi’s response was rather objective, “You’re about to be caught.”

“What?” What Pen Carries Fragrance didn’t dare to look back during his mad dash, and only when he heard that did he hesitantly glance back. The unprecedented and ruthless scene made his heart race, and he spoke with a trembling voice, “So what do I do now!?”

“Stop running when you reach the coordinates, there’s no way you’ll escape anyway.” Jiang Shi’s tone was calm, as if he were making arrangements for the aftermath. “Guild leader, help What Pen Carries Fragrance restore some health, then find a place to hide. Everyone else should focus on staying alive; let the stage belong to them.”

Island Forest left without a second thought, “Okay, dear.”

What Pen Carries Fragrance, feeling weak and helpless, said, “What? What stage? Everyone’s gone, what do I do, main guild leader?”

Jiang Shi glanced at Yu Weize, who had already hidden with him in the nearby reeds, and said, “Everyone’s gone to hide.”

He comforted with a smile, “What Pen Carries Fragrance, you just have to bear with it for a while. We’ll give you a mental damage fee after we finish off the boss.”

What Pen Carries Fragrance: “?”

Yu Weize had actually retreated faster than Jiang Shi. Hearing the familiar and life-threatening tone, he couldn’t help but laugh and added, “This is What Pen Carries Fragrance, and Madman Tate is with you.”

Jiang Shi glanced at this guy, who was just enjoying the show, “Yes, Madman Tate is with you, What Pen Carries Fragrance.”

“…!” What Pen Carries Fragrance looked around at his teammates, who had suddenly disappeared, and before he could blurt out a curse, he was hit head-on by a bunch of incoming skills. He was instantly left speechless.

It wasn’t that he didn’t want to run, but after all, the BOSS’s aggro was still on him. Even if he wanted to run, the other three guilds wouldn’t let him!

With his death, the field of vision before him dimmed.

In the team channel, What Pen Carries Fragrance began to vent his grievances, “And then? And then? I died, the BOSS is almost dead, and my aggro was taken back by those guild members. What’s next?!”

Jiang Shi hid in a nearby reed bed, observing Madman Tate’s health points. “Don’t worry, it’s almost time.”

What Pen Carries Fragrance: [What time? Is it the time where I’m about to get killed by them?]

Jiang Shi’s tone was slow and steady. “Just wait.”

Shen Jing Bing didn’t say a word, but the results of his actions had already revealed everything.

What Pen Carries Fragrance finally understood the meaning of “just wait.”

The consecutive explosions that followed covered the team’s voice channel with deafening noise, and you could faintly hear the commanders’ shocked exclamations.

At the moment when the smoke and flames rose, a black cloud of smoke enveloped the entire area around Madman Tate, completely swallowing it.

Even the boss’s health had directly dropped from 8% to its final 3%. The damage was immense, let alone the players caught in the blast radius.

This scene was so spectacular that the members of the three guilds were left dumbfounded, unable to enjoy the satisfaction of reclaiming the boss from another guild before being completely bewildered by the continuous explosions.

The 65th-level skill of the Deep Gnome Artillery Specialist profession, Land Mine Formation, was widely known for its limited use but high damage potential.

No one knew how many landmines had been planted in this area beforehand. Only the gruesome scene after the explosions hinted at what had just transpired.

Looking around, it was a battlefield of corpses, with the souls of the fallen seeking no peace.

Only What Pen Carries Fragrance’s repeated “What the h*ck” in the team channel could express the shock of the moment.

Even though pain-related metrics in the full-immersion game had been scaled down significantly, experiencing such a massive explosion was undoubtedly traumatic.

Jiang Shi felt deep sympathy for all the people who had been caught in the explosions. So, together with Yu Weize, they once again revealed themselves and quickly cleared the area.

With their minds and bodies hurt, the guild members from the explosions were easy to eliminate. As for those who were still fighting on the periphery, it was apparent that they wouldn’t be able to reach this place quickly while engaging in mutual restraints.

It would take even more time for those who had died at the scene to revive and return.

After dealing with the last Night Raid team member, Jiang Shi said in the team voice channel, “Alright, everyone can come over now, find a place to hide, and let’s kill the boss.”

He added, “What Pen Carries Fragrance, you just lie down and rest. If you resurrect now, you might run into members of the other guilds.”

What Pen Carries Fragrance: “…”

Thank you for your thoughtfulness.

Although there weren’t many members of the Seven Silver Coins, What Pen Carries Fragrance, even though he had fallen, had managed to bring in Yu Weize, an exceptionally effective explosive damage dealer.

Madman Tate’s already low health points were rapidly decreasing.

2%, 1%, 0.7%…

Jiang Shi continued to watch Yu Weize’s actions and found that this guy was still outputting very seriously, with no signs of any ulterior motives.

Not only that, Yu Weize even casually conversed with him, “Should I add friends back later?”

Could it be that he had truly changed?

Jiang Shi, watching Yu Wei Ze’s attitude, also gave this question a bit of consideration.

Just as he was thinking, Island Forest suddenly exclaimed, “Look, on the hillside over there, is someone coming after us?”

Jiang Shi looked in that direction and saw the approaching Crusader army.

His eyebrows raised slightly, and he made a natural association, looking back at Yu Weize with a smile that was more of a smirk.

At this point, Yu Weize had also received a message from his good disciple.

[Green Fanatic: Master, I see you! Why are you in a team? Hurry and leave so I can invite you.]

Yu Weize: “…”

He closed the chat without replying and asked, “Would you believe me if I said I’m not familiar with them?”

Jiang Shi showed a kind smile, “Of course, I believe.”

The next moment, Yu Weize received two system messages.

[System: You have been removed from the team.]

[System: Green Fanatic has sent a team invitation. [Accept] or [Reject].]

Helpless, Yu Weize let the Seven Silver Coins team’s skills land on him without dodging. As his vision dimmed after death, he could only watch as those people quickly finished off the last bit of Madman Tate’s health and then scattered, leaving without looking back.

Watching the gradually retreating familiar figures, he thought for a moment, then sent a friend request using the game ID [Material Main Account]

[System: Sorry, your friend request has been rejected.]

He tried again.

[System: Sorry, the other party has rejected all friend requests.]

At the same time.

[Green Fanatic: Master, are you there? Join the group first!]

[Green Fanatic: Master, why did you go offline?!]

[Green Fanatic: Who did this? I’ve already brought people over; watch me make them pay!]

Yu Weize: “…”

How do you get kicked out of a sect in this game?
